
I finally landed a high-paying summer internship; and it's about time. This past Monday was my first day as an employee of the Federal Government - Social Security Administration.
My job seems interesting so far. Basically, when an individual is denied disability benefits through SS, they can appeal that denial. When they appeal, a Federal administrative law judge decides whether or not to grant them disability benefits or to uphold the denial. My job is to review cases and write memorandums for the judges, who review all cases for western New York.
For the entire first week of the job I am doing nothing but reading a three inch thick stack of papers covering Social Security law, and already I know more than I ever wanted to about SSI and disability benefits. The attorney supervising me promised to help break up the monotony of studying in a cubicle all day; so this morning I am supposed to begin attending claimant hearings with the judges and attorneys so I can watch the proceedings.
